Soluble concentrate with high micronutrient content. The metallic elements are chelated by EDTA and the non-metallic elements are soluble in water. QUELAFERT® MICROS-L, being a liquid formulation, has great advantages over solid formulations: its dosage is easier, it does not produce sedimentation or caking, its solubility is total and it does not clog the filtering systems of modern irrigation systems. QUELAFERT® MICROS-L has a high content (5.2%) in Iron (Fe), making it a very suitable formulation for urgent corrective treatments (rescue treatments) of iron chlorosis, since the response of the treated plant is immediate.
pH range in which a good stability of the chelated fraction is guaranteed: pH between: 2 and 10.

| Boron (Bo) water soluble | 0,52% p/v | 0,40% p/p | 
| Water-soluble zinc (Zn) | 0,65% p/v | 0,50% p/p | 
| Zinc (Zn) chelated by EDTA | 0,65% p/v | 0,50% p/p | 
| Water-soluble copper (Cu) | 0,39% p/v | 0,30% p/p | 
| EDTA chelated copper (Cu) | 0,39% p/v | 0,30% p/p | 
| Iron (Fe) soluble in water | 5,20% p/v | 4,0% p/p | 
| Iron (Fe) chelated by EDTA | 5,20% p/v | 4,0% p/p | 
| Manganese (Mn) water soluble | 2,48% p/v | 1,9% p/p | 
| Manganese (Mn) chelated by EDTA | 2,48% p/v | 1,9% p/p | 
| Molybdenum (Mo) | 0.13% p/v | 0.10% p/p | 
| Density | 1,3g/cc | |
| pH (1% solution) | 2 | 
| Once the leaves have reached their full development | Foliar Spraying: at 0,1% | 
| From the beginning of cultivation, every 7-15 days depending on the crop. | Root application. 100ml/1000m2 (1L/Ha) | 
| Continuously in the nutrient solution, from the start | Fertirrigation: 0,025ml/L | 
It can be applied to all types of crops: horticultural crops, fruit trees, vines, olive trees, strawberries, ornamentals, etc.
